Output 8b814025d89c0e859cf107fa57f17f1b6ea60b4d1eaa6d77b7610209f8467303:0

value
186079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 819251351512c65e9ada36a4f474ac8aa976de74 OP_EQUAL
address
3DW8Nb5FkQqSafkp6A4mUbdTpFdVTuSEPg
transaction
8b814025d89c0e859cf107fa57f17f1b6ea60b4d1eaa6d77b7610209f8467303
spent
true